Road cycling around Villanterio, located in Lombardy, Italy, features a diverse landscape of cultivated land, preserved woods, and river oxbows. The terrain primarily offers flat routes suitable for varied fitness levels, with some options traversing areas near the Navigli canals and Ticino River. While the immediate vicinity is generally flat, the region provides access to the Oltrepò Pavese hills for more challenging climbs. This area combines agricultural scenery with natural features, offering a range of road cycling experiences.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many road cycling routes are available around Villanterio?

Villanterio offers a wide selection of road cycling routes, with over 150 tours available. These routes cater to various skill levels, including easy, moderate, and difficult options.

What kind of terrain can I expect when road cycling near Villanterio?

The immediate vicinity of Villanterio features primarily flat routes, ideal for leisurely rides through cultivated land, preserved woods, and river oxbows. However, for those seeking more challenging terrain, the nearby Oltrepò Pavese hills offer significant climbs and panoramic vineyard views.

Are there challenging road cycling routes for experienced riders?

Yes, while many routes are flat, experienced riders can find challenging options. The Oltrepò Pavese hills, easily accessible from Villanterio, are known for their demanding climbs. For example, routes around Monte Penice offer significant ascents and rewarding views. The region also features longer, more difficult routes like the 'TriangoloLargo Navigli variante' (120.9 km with 149m ascent) and the 'Randonnee Riso e Vino' (210 km with over 1,000 meters of ascent).

Can I find easy or beginner-friendly road cycling routes in the area?

Absolutely. Villanterio is well-suited for easy and beginner-friendly road cycling, with 78 easy routes available. A popular choice is the Medieval Fountain of Bascapè – Country road with canal loop from Sant'Angelo Lodigiano, an easy 44.0 km trail that follows country roads and a canal loop.

What are some scenic routes with notable landmarks or natural features?

Many routes offer scenic views through agricultural landscapes, preserved woods, and along river oxbows. You can also cycle along the Navigli canals and the Ticino River within Parco del Ticino. For historical interest, the ancient Via Francigena, a European Cultural Route, runs within a few kilometers of Villanterio, offering a unique cycling experience.

What are some popular attractions or points of interest to visit while cycling?

The region boasts several historical and cultural attractions. You can integrate visits to places like the Chignolo Po Castle or the San Colombano Castle into your rides. The historic Certosa di Pavia is also often included in local cycling loops, combining cultural sightseeing with outdoor activity.

Are there family-friendly road cycling options around Villanterio?

Yes, the predominantly flat terrain around Villanterio makes it suitable for family-friendly road cycling. Many easy routes traverse quiet country roads and paths along canals, providing a safe and enjoyable experience for all ages. The Basilica of San Bassiano – Graffignana Cycle Bridge loop from Inverno e Monteleone is an easy 36.0 km route that could be suitable for families.

What is the best season for road cycling in Villanterio?

The best seasons for road cycling in Villanterio are typically spring and autumn, when temperatures are mild and the landscapes are vibrant. Summer can also be pleasant, especially in the mornings or late afternoons, though it can get warm. Winter cycling is possible but may require more preparation for colder conditions.

Are there circular road cycling routes available?

Yes, many of the routes around Villanterio are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end your ride in the same location. For example, the Ciaparat Chapel – Banine Ascent: The Woods loop from Torre d'Arese is a moderate 55.0 km circular path that includes an ascent and passes through wooded areas.

What do other road cyclists enjoy the most about road cycling in Villanterio?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.2 stars from over 50 reviews. Reviewers often praise the diverse landscape, from cultivated fields to preserved woods and river oxbows, and the variety of routes catering to different fitness levels. The accessibility to both flat, scenic rides and challenging climbs in the Oltrepò Pavese hills is also a highlight.

Can I find routes that are under 50 km for a shorter ride?

Certainly. Villanterio offers numerous shorter road cycling routes. For instance, the Graffignana Cycle Bridge – Ciaparat Chapel loop from Monteleone is a 23.1 km trail through agricultural landscapes, perfect for a ride under an hour. Another option is the Ciaparat Chapel – Road Towards the Hills loop from Sant'Angelo Lodigiano, which is 27.4 km long.
